This enclosure holds 1.10 cu ft net per chamber. In it the Hertz Mille Pro MP 300 runs a system Qtc of 0.77 with half power at 40.7 Hz, and the cone reaches its 17.0 mm travel limit at 578 W, below the driver’s 600 W thermal rating, so travel is what stops you here, not heat. Run a subsonic filter at 25 Hz and that becomes 744 W — +166 W, or 29 percent more power for the same 17.0 mm of travel.

01Is it a sealed driver?

Efficiency bandwidth product places the motor before anything else is decided.

EBP = Fs ÷ Qes = 53.3
SEALED 0–50 TRANSITION 50–100 PORTED 100–150 0 50 100 150 D4 53.3
D4 · EBP 53.3
At 53.3 the MP 300 sits in the transition band, not the sealed band. That is not a mismatch: a transition motor works in either alignment, and sealed buys a smaller box and a gentler roll-off at the cost of some low-end output. Stage 02 shows what this airspace actually does with it.

02What the box does to it

1.10 cu ft against a 74.0 L Vas.

α = Vas ÷ Vb = 2.38  ·  Fc = Fs√(α+1) = 44 Hz  ·  Qtc = 0.77
20 30 50 70 100 150 200 +6 +0 -6 -12 -18 -24 FREQUENCY · Hz LEVEL · dB −3 dB
D4 · Qtc 0.77, Fc 44 Hz, F3 40.7 Hz
The box lifts resonance from 24.0 Hz free-air to 44 Hz and half power lands at 40.7 Hz, anechoic, before any cabin gain.

03The watts that reach Xmax (in this enclosure)

Travel scales with the square root of power, so there is one wattage that puts the cone exactly on 17.0 mm — and a bigger one once a subsonic filter stops it wasting travel below the passband.

PXmax = 578 W unfiltered  →  744 W with a 25 Hz subsonic
20 30 50 70 100 150 200 0 4 8 12 16 20 FREQUENCY · Hz CONE TRAVEL · mm PAST LINEAR TRAVEL · Xmax 17.0 mm 578 W reaches Xmax here
D4 · 578 W, no filterD4 · 744 W with subsonic at 25 Hz, 24 dB/octXmax 17.0 mm one-way
Every trace touches the limit and no further, because each is drawn at the exact power that puts that coil on 17.0 mm. Unfiltered that is 578 W, reached first at 20 Hz. It sits under the 600 W the driver can take thermally, so the enclosure sets the ceiling, not the voice coil. The dashed traces are the same driver behind a subsonic filter at 25 Hz, 24 dB/oct: stopping the cone wasting travel below the passband lets it take 744 W before hitting the same 17.0 mm. That is 29 percent more amplifier for the price of one filter setting.

Installer's take

86 dB sensitivity. That is the number to pay attention to on this driver. Most subwoofers in this program sit in the low to mid 80s and several drop to 81 or 82, which means they need real amplifier power just to keep up. The MP 300 gets meaningfully louder on the same watts.

Pair that with a 24 Hz free-air resonance and 74 liters of Vas and you have a driver with genuine capability rather than a spec sheet built for a price point. Qts of 0.42 is low enough to reach a properly damped sealed alignment.

Hertz recommends 28 liters and this cabinet gives 31, because the 6.46 inch mounting depth sets the floor on internal height. That extra volume moves Qtc from their published 0.82 down to 0.771, which is the right direction. Worth noting their published figures reconcile with their own T/S: run their numbers at their own 28 liter volume and you get 0.80 against a published 0.82. Close enough that I trust the rest of the sheet.

The V-cone profile is the real thing rather than styling. Pressing paper pulp with mineral powder injection is the same process Hertz uses on Mille Legend, and the profile keeps the cone acting like a piston instead of flexing at the edge under load. 65mm four-layer CCAW coil on a vented former, high-density ferrite motor, BL of 12.

17mm of linear excursion with 27mm of mechanical travel before damage. 600 watts RMS. At 86 dB you do not need to chase the rating to get where you want to be.

One honest note: we do not offer a dual 12 in this driver. The MP 300 wants close to a cubic foot per chamber, and on a halved footprint that volume has to come entirely from height, which pushes the cabinet past 11 inches. Two singles is the better build.

Questions

Why is this enclosure larger than Hertz's recommended 28 liters?

Because the driver's mounting depth sets the minimum cabinet height. The MP 300 mounts 6.46 inches deep. Our double baffle recovers 0.75 inches since the outer layer is a flush recess and the driver bolts to the inner layer, and a 3/8 inch milled relief behind the magnet recovers a little more. With half an inch of clearance behind the motor the minimum internal height is 5.875 inches, which works out to 1.10 cubic feet net.

The extra volume helps. Hertz publishes Qtc 0.82 at their 28 liter figure. At the 31 liters this cabinet provides, the system lands at Qtc 0.771 with F3 at 40.7 Hz. Better damped with a gentler corner and no meaningful loss anywhere.

Why is 86 dB sensitivity significant?

Because sensitivity determines how much output you get per watt. Most subwoofers in this category sit in the low to mid 80s, and high-excursion shallow drivers frequently drop to 81 or 82 dB as a tradeoff for their motor design. At 86 dB the MP 300 is among the most efficient drivers in the Proline X Down Fire line.

In practical terms a 4 dB sensitivity advantage means roughly two and a half times the acoustic output from the same amplifier power. You can reach your target output on a smaller amplifier, or reach it with headroom to spare on a large one, which reduces thermal stress on the driver over long listening sessions.

Do you offer a dual 12 inch MP 300 enclosure?

No, and the reason is worth explaining. The MP 300 has 74 liters of Vas and wants close to a cubic foot of net airspace per driver for a good alignment. In a dual chamber cabinet the footprint is split in half, so all of that volume has to come from height instead.

Running the numbers, a dual MP 300 down fire enclosure would need to stand over 11 inches tall to reach even 0.80 cubic feet per chamber, and building it shorter pushes Qtc past 1.0 which produces a peaky, poorly controlled alignment. Two single enclosures deliver better sound in a more usable form factor. Drivers with a smaller Vas, like the Mille Pro MPS series, work well as duals in this format.

How do I wire this enclosure and set my impedance?

The enclosure has one side-mounted Proline X terminal cup pre-wired in 12 gauge OFC. Final impedance is set at the driver, and it depends on which version you buy.

The MP 300 D2.3 has dual 2-ohm coils: parallel gives 1 ohm, series gives 4 ohms. The MP 300 D4.3 has dual 4-ohm coils: parallel gives 2 ohms, series gives 8. Hertz rates the driver at 600 watts RMS. Confirm your amplifier is stable at your chosen load before powering the system.

How does the MP 300 compare to the 10 inch MP 250?

The 12 is more efficient and has more cone area; the 10 has a slightly lower F3 in its cabinet. The MP 300 measures 86 dB sensitivity against the MP 250's 83.4, which is a substantial real-world difference, and it has a lower free-air resonance at 24 Hz against 30 Hz.

In their respective enclosures the 10 reaches F3 39.4 Hz at Qtc 0.741 and the 12 reaches 40.7 Hz at Qtc 0.771, so the 10 edges it on paper. But the 12 moves far more air and gets louder on less power. Both share the same 600 watt rating and 17mm of excursion. Cabinet heights are 7.4375 inches for the 10 and 8.125 for the 12.

How is this enclosure built?

V-groove and dado joinery, CNC-cut on ShopSabre routers from Langboard Elite MDF. Every panel joint is a machined interlocking groove that mechanically locks the panels before adhesive is applied, which is what keeps the cabinet airtight under sustained pressure cycling.

The front baffle is a double layer at 1.5 inches, two bonded 3/4 inch sheets, with the outer layer machined as a flush recess so the driver bolts to the inner layer. That recovers 3/4 inch of internal clearance and matters with an 11.30 inch cutout. A 3/8 inch relief is milled into the opposite panel behind the magnet. Perimeter cross-bracing and pre-installed polyfill complete the build. Assembled and inspected in Tullahoma, Tennessee.
